Abstract

The study was performed to evaluate the effectiveness of single and multiple inoculation of beneficial microorganisms on growth and nutrients uptake of Chinese Kale (Brassica oleracea var. alboglabra). The experiment was performed in plug tray containing coconut husk compost as seedling media. The media was inoculated with single or multiple isolates of Azospirillum sp. (VAs 2), Beijerinckia sp. (VBe 75) and Actinomycetes (VAc 077). Randomized Complete Block Design was applied and each treatment was repeated three times. The results demonstrated that triple inoculation with VAs 2, VBe 75, and VAc 077 gave the highest shoot dry weight (2.927 g/plant) with the value of 20% higher than that of the control. Single inoculation with VAc 077 gave the highest root dry weight (0.360 g/plant) with the value of 32% higher than that of the control. The use of single and multiple isolates increased all
nutrient elements uptake (N, P, K, Ca and Mg) especially for N uptake which was 61% higher than the control.
